What is an Online Fax Service?

If you're not familiar with this new way of faxing, just remember, Internet faxing is simply using your email system and the web to send and receive your faxes. You sign-up for an online service and you're given a local or Toll-Free fax number which you use to send your faxes. Your online fax service acts as an intermediary on your behalf to handle all your faxes.

You are also given an online site (interface) where you can store your faxes. You can also send and receive your faxes from this online account. Your faxes are sent as email attachments, usually in TIFF or PDF formats. You can send your faxes to other online fax users or you can send faxes to other traditional fax machines and vice versa - again, your online fax service acts as your intermediary.

Why is it very Cost-effective to use online fax?

There are many cost saving factors to using Internet fax. First, there is no need for an extra phone line and there is no need for paper and inks/toners since online faxing is totally paperless. This can mean significant savings especially when a business or company is just starting up.

Furthermore, the monthly charges for using an online service is around $10 but you can get cheaper services if your faxing requirements are very minimum - some as low as $20 a year. The key is to shop around and compare fax services to find the perfect fit to match your needs. This is usually a long-term service so you can achieve large savings by doing your homework now!

Some of the major Internet fax providers are: MyFax, RingCentral, eFax, TrustFax, Send2Fax, RappidFax, MetroFax and Faxage. All have slightly different plans and services so again, it pays to shop around before you buy or sign-on to any of these services.

In addition, most of these fax services are completely scalable for business so you can quickly adjust your type of service should your company's faxing needs increase or decrease. In other words, you can quickly scale up your faxing lines and numbers to keep in sync with any sudden expansion or growth in your company. This alone can save you money and business.
